Lifestyle Desk – With the arrival of the month of Sawan, greenery, showers of rain and an atmosphere of devotion to Lord Shiva are seen everywhere. This month is considered as important from a religious point of view as it is a symbol of positivity and happiness in the home. During this time, many people like to decorate their homes in a special way along with worshipping Lord Shiva. The good thing is that there is no need to buy expensive decorative items for this. With some common things available in the house and a little creativity, you can give your home a beautiful and traditional look. If you want to make your home attractive and festive this Sawan, then definitely try these 5 easy decoration ideas.
Make a garland of mango and Ashoka leaves.
In Indian tradition, it’s considered auspicious to hang a festoon of mango or Ashoka leaves at the main door. During the month of Sawan, you can create a festoon of fresh green leaves and hang it at the main door. This will give your home a natural and traditional look, while also making the entrance look truly attractive.
Decorate the puja corner with flowers
Worshiping Lord Shiva holds special significance during the month of Sawan. Therefore, decorate your home temple or place of worship with fresh flowers. Make garlands of flowers like marigold, jasmine, mogra, and rose and place them in the temple. You can also create a small rangoli using flower petals, which will enhance the beautiful appearance of your place of worship.
Make earthen lamps and brass decorations
Not only during Diwali, but also during the month of Sawan, earthen lamps and brass decorative items can enhance the beauty of your home. Lighting a ghee or oil lamp after evening prayers creates a positive atmosphere in your home. A brass bell, a vase, or a small Shiva statue can also enhance your decor.
Adopt a green theme
The month of Sawan is considered a symbol of greenery, so use green more often in your home decor. Green cushion covers, table runners, curtains, or artificial vines can give your living room a fresh look. If you have indoor plants, arrange them in beautiful pots and place them in different corners of the room. This will make your home look fresh and vibrant.
Enhance beauty with rangoli and handmade decorations
During the month of Sawan, create a rangoli with flowers or natural colors in front of the main door or place of worship. Alternatively, use handmade decorative items made from old glass bottles, clay pots, or paper. This is not only a budget-friendly option but also gives your home a unique and personal look.
Maintain simplicity with your decorations
Sawan is considered a month of spirituality and connection with nature. Therefore, when decorating, prioritize natural colors, flowers, and traditional decorative items over excessive flashiness. This will keep the atmosphere calm, positive, and festive.
